revert(nvim)+fix(remote-dev): keep Mason authoritative, give it cargo+rustc
User policy: Mason should install everything it lists regardless of host-provided versions. Revert the PATH-filtering wrapper around ensure_installed (b2f129e) — back to a plain table literal. For shellharden specifically, Mason's only install source is `cargo install`. The Arch host has cargo via base-devel/rustup; the VM previously didn't, so Mason errored "ENOENT cargo". Add `cargo` and `rustc` to the remote-dev nix profile so Mason can build it on the VM too. Drop the shellharden package from home.nix — Mason owns it now, no more provider competition with the nix-profile binary.
